But seriously, what is the current realistic alternative to Flash for 
embedding audio/video content on web pages?
I've been trying to promote SMIL (http://www.w3.org/AudioVideo/) which 
I've worked quite a bit but I guess very few had even ever heard of it 
on this list.
And of course now there's upcoming HTML 5 
(http://dev.w3.org/html5/spec/Overview.html and demos: 
http://htmlfive.appspot.com/) which is already supported on firefox 3.5 
and seems promising (yet if no hosting site will support it it'll 
probably prove rather unsuccessful).
